SoCon Week #3 Pick 'em and Power Poll
Predictions
- Furman at Va Tech – Va Tech has been fading lately, but they will handle Furman with not too much drama – 44-17
- Chattanooga at Tennessee – The Vols are 0-2 and ripe for the Mocs…just kidding, they are pissed and will take it out on them – 48-9
- The Citadel at Ga Tech – Of the 3 FBS games this week, I think the Dogs have the best shot, not a good one, but the best; Ga Tech is still trying to find their new offensive scheme…but then again, the Dogs are still trying to find their legs as well; They had a good O the first game, them a bad outing, but I will point to some hurricane hangover for that, at least a little bit; The Dogs special teams was lights out against Elon (two blocked punts deep in Elon territory and an onsides kick recovery) … all three resulted in TDs for the Dogs, so they know how to fight hard as a team; GaTech knows how to defend against the option, they have been beaten down by Clemson and barely squeaked by a bad South Florida team, they will be hungry; if the Dogs can put it all together, and improve their D a little bit, they have a shot, but I fear GaTech will finally put their new scheme together first – 42-17
- North Greenville at WCU – The Cats may be reeling if the whole player suspension thing gets worse; I am going to assume it plays itself out and the players involved are disciplined, repentant and playing on Saturday – 41-21
- Samford at Wofford – Will Samford stick to their air raid or try to run a little more? Will Wofford go full hog option again? Interesting to see what will happen. I am going to go with Wofford as it returns to its old ways including a stout D that "finally" handles Samford… Wofford hasn’t beaten Samford the last 4 times up – 31-28
- Austin Peay at Mercer – The Peay had Central Arkansas on the ropes only to lose late last week. Mercer has handled them so far, (3-0 the last few years) but the Peay is better…but so is Mercer, Bears win home comfortably – 41-24
- VMI at ETSU – VMI had lots of close games last year; if this was in Lexington I would pick the Keydets, but on the road…gotta go with the Bucs – 37-28

Weems and Maples both didn't play - Cally Chizik played most if not all of the second half for Trapp. So, Furman played most of the game with two freshmen corners.
Looks like we will continue to see the heavy offensive line rotation. The GSU announcers seemed confused by Furman's strategy - basically considering it a negative - not sure based on how productive the O was that's true. Furman's rotating at center, guard and tackle.
Lost in the shuffle of Furman's three- headed running back monster is the play of RSFR fullback Devin Abrams - two game totals - 50 yards rushing 1 td, 52 yards receiving 1 td. I'd love to know his block rating?
